How Online Christian Small Groups Strengthen Your Faith
Joining online christian small groups is a wonderful way to build faith in a supportive environment. These groups are designed to be intimate and interactive, allowing you to dive deeper into Scripture and apply it to your daily life.
Here’s how these small groups can make a difference:
Personalized Attention: With fewer members, everyone has a chance to share and be heard. This creates a safe space for honest conversations about faith, doubts, and life challenges.
Accountability and Encouragement: Regular meetings help you stay committed to your spiritual goals. Group members cheer you on and pray for you, which can be incredibly motivating.
Learning Together: Small groups often study the Bible or Christian books together. This shared learning experience helps you understand God’s Word more clearly and see how it applies to your life.
Prayer Support: Prayer is powerful, and praying with others strengthens your connection to God. Small groups often dedicate time to pray for each other’s needs, creating a strong spiritual bond.

Where Can I Make Christian Friends Online?
Making genuine Christian friendships online is easier than you might think. Many digital fellowship communities and online churches provide spaces specifically for building relationships beyond Sunday services.
Here are some places to explore:
Online Church Small Groups: These are often the best places to meet like-minded believers. You’ll find groups for different ages, life stages, and interests.
Christian Forums and Social Media Groups: Platforms like Facebook and specialized Christian forums host groups where you can join discussions, ask questions, and share your faith journey.
Virtual Bible Studies and Prayer Meetings: Many churches host regular online Bible studies and prayer sessions that encourage interaction and friendship.
Christian Apps and Websites: Some apps are designed to connect Christians for fellowship, mentorship, and support.
When you join these spaces, be open and authentic. Share your story, listen to others, and don’t hesitate to reach out for prayer or advice. Friendships formed in faith communities often become lifelong blessings.

Practical Tips for Thriving in Online Christian Small Groups
Joining an online small group is just the beginning. To truly benefit and build lasting connections, here are some practical tips:
Be Consistent: Attend meetings regularly. Consistency helps build trust and deepens relationships.
Engage Actively: Participate in discussions, share your thoughts, and ask questions. Your voice matters.
Respect Privacy: What’s shared in the group stays in the group. This creates a safe environment for everyone.
Use Technology Confidently: Familiarize yourself with the platform used for meetings. This reduces stress and helps you focus on fellowship.
Pray for Your Group: Lift up your group members in prayer between meetings. This strengthens your spiritual connection.
Invite Others: If you know someone who could benefit, invite them to join. Growing the group enriches everyone’s experience.
